Catalan

edit

Etymology

edit

From gralla +‎ -ar.

Pronunciation

edit

Verb

edit

grallar (first-person singular present grallo, first-person singular preterite grallí, past participle grallat)

  1. to caw (make the cry of a crow)

Galician

edit

Etymology

edit

From gralla (jackdaw).

Pronunciation

edit

Verb

edit

grallar (first-person singular present grallo, first-person singular preterite grallei, past participle grallado)

  1. to squawk
  2. to caw
    Synonyms: croar, gacear
